Prompt gamma-ray cascades in neutron-rich nuclei around doubly-magic S
n-132 have been studied at Eurogam 2 array using a Cm-248 fission sour
ce. Yrast states to above 5.5 MeV in the two- and three-proton N = 82
isotones Te-134 and I-135 are reported. They are interpreted in terms
of valence proton and particle-hole core excitations with the help of
shell model calculations employing empirical nucleon-nucleon interacti
ons from both Sn-132 and Pb-208 regions. A serious inconsistency in th
e accepted masses of N = 82 isotones near Sn-132 is discovered but not
resolved.
